Hurricane Glass Centerpieces Ideas

Save money as you create your own hurricane glass centerpiece for that special occasion. Hurricane glass centerpieces combine the simple, graceful curves of the container with the candles and flowers displayed. Their bottleneck design focuses the eye to the arrangement on top, while the wider base showcases the material below. Match the design to your occasion with your choice of flowers and base materials.


Frosted Glass


As most hurricane containers are clear glass, give yours more character and detail by frosting the glass. This process involves placing a stencil, leaf or tape over the glass and spraying the frost on. Theme the stencil for the centerpiece to occasions, such as wedding bells for the reception, hearts for Valentine's Day or shamrocks for St. Pat's Day. Fill the base with iridescent glass beads, marbles or beaded pearls and add a taper candle.


Design Wrap


Theme the hurricane glass centerpiece to your occasion. Pick self-adhesive paper, the color of your celebration, and use a stencil to cut out a design. Designs may include angels for Christmas, ghosts for Halloween or flags for July Fourth. Attach the paper to the hurricane glass. Fill a Christmas display with poinsettia flowers surrounded by a wreath of holly, put wrapped candy into the Halloween glass and stick pinwheels, small flags on sticks and red carnations in a patriotic centerpiece.


Beach


For a wedding at the beach, use sand, shells, small toy surfboards or canoes in your centerpiece. A large banana leaf inserted into the hurricane glass provides a tropical touch, while seashells give weight to the base. Add water and float a starfish or flip-flop candle on top.


Candy


Candy centerpieces work well in the hurricane vase. Group several hurricane vases together in the center of the table and fill each with different types of candy. For Valentine's Day include small wrapped chocolate hearts, small message hearts and wrapped chocolate kisses. For a child's birthday, use peanut butter cups, small bags of M&M's or Skittles. For Halloween, use candy corn, ghost pops or marshmallow shapes.
